    Default Linking My 2 graphs


    I have a humminbird 899 at the console and 859 on trolling motor. How do I link these 2 graphs together? If I do this, when I mark a waypoint on one graph, will it automatically create one on the other graph? Where is a good place to buy one and the best price?     You will need 1 Ethernet cable ...(AS EC xE ... Where "x" is the cable length) ...
    Humminbird | AS EC 2E

    You will need 2 Ethernet adapter cables ...
    Humminbird | AS EC QDE

    Ethernet allows 1 unit to read and display waypoints from the other unit's library ... Displaying the waypoint in a different color ...

    Waypoints are not physically transferred into the other unit library ...

    Both units have to be powered on and set to share waypoint data ...

    If you mark a waypoint on a specific unit and then power off that unit ... The remaining "powered on" unit can no longer "see" that waypoint from the "powered off" unit ...

    LowePro, I did same earlier with my two HB units. The Ethernet cable is not what you would use on a computer. They have screw on water tight connections. Your going to love sharing waypoints. I use my SI to explore and mark bush piles, then use shared waypoint on front unit to dial in. Once I find it, I will mark on front unit.

    BTW this is much easier to do than you think. Just get parts mentioned above.

    The AS-EC-QDE Ethernet Adapter Cable will fit either the 859 or 899 units (plus many others), but you will need one for each unit. These adapter cables should be available from Humminbird retailers.

    The Ethernet cables that we use have the M12, 8-position type connectors.
